diff --git a/Dockerfile b/Dockerfile index 96502db..b2348ef 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,11 +1,12 @@ FROM golang:latest -RUN mkdir /app -RUN mkdir -p /app -WORKDIR /app -RUN go get -u -RUN go build -o main . -CMD ["/app/main"] -ADD . /app -RUN go build ./main.go -CMD ["./main"] \ No newline at end of file +RUN mkdir /app +WORKDIR /app +RUN mkdir /go +RUN export GOPATH=/app/go +COPY main.go . +RUN go get +WORKDIR $GOPATH/src/git.cliffbreak.de/Cliffbreak/tsviewer +RUN go build +EXPOSE 8080 +CMD ["./tsviewer"] \ No newline at end of file